What Types of Pants are Best For Hiking?
Choosing the right pants is important for hiking. Hiking pants can protect you from abrasions, bugs, and poisonous plants. They also provide comfort and freedom of movement. They are also useful for hiking in hot climates.
Hiking pants are often made of nylon or polyester. These materials are breathable and stretchy. They are also water-resistant. They have a gusseted crotch that increases mobility and reduces abrasion.
Some fabrics have a two-way stretch, meaning they stretch across the thighs and knees. Others have a four-way stretch, meaning they stretch both crosswise and lengthwise.
Some hiking pants have a waistband that has Velcro and an integrated belt. Others have “pull-on” systems that don’t require a belt.
In addition to being comfortable, hiking pants should be designed for different types of terrain. Those in the desert require a different type of pants than those in the mountains. The pants should also be able to convert into shorts.
In addition to comfort, it is important to choose pants that are durable and water-repellent. Some fabrics have an anti-UV treatment that keeps you safe from the sun.

What are the 2 Tips For Hiking?
Whether you are an experienced hiker or you are planning your first hike, there are two important tips to keep in mind. Hiking can be a great way to spend time outdoors and improve your overall well-being.
One of the most important tips for hiking is to plan your hike ahead of time. This will save you from unexpected encounters. It also helps you to determine how much time you have to complete your hike.
You should also prepare your hiking gear. This includes your backpack, water bottle, and sun protection. Taking breaks often can help to keep you from getting tired and overheating.
You should also pack food with good nutritional value. You can also pack a small flashlight or headlamp. You should also pack a personal locator beacon (PLB) to send SOS in the event of an emergency.
You should also carry a basic first aid kit. This should contain bandages, antiseptic cream, and pain relief medication.
You should also check the weather before you leave. You can do this by visiting the park’s website. You should also keep an eye out for any park alerts. These could include a trail closure, wildland fire risks, or other issues.
